@charset "UTF-8";
/* CSS Document */

	
	body {
	margin:10px 10px 0px 10px;
	padding:0px;
	background-image: url(../images/black_red_bg.gif);
	background-repeat: repeat-x;
	background-color: #AE0000;
	margin-top: 0px;
		}
	
	#picture {
	position: relative;
	left:52px;
	top:-1356px;
	width:150px;
	z-index: 10;
	height: 300px;
		}
html>body #picture {
	position: relative;
	left:52px;
	top:-1350px;
	width:150px;
	z-index: 10;
	height: 300px;
		}
#leftcontent {
	position: relative;
	left:53px;
	top:-1270px;
	width:145px;
	z-index: 10;
	height: 264px;
	overflow: hidden;
}

#bhangra {
	voice-family: "\"}\"";
	voice-family: inherit;
	width: 300px;
	position: relative;
	left: 233px;
	top: -1545px;
	z-index: 10;
		}
	html>body #bhangra {
		}		

#myspacebook {
	position: relative;
	left:565px;
	top:-586px;
	width:145px;
	z-index: 10;
	height: 177px;
		}
		#maillist {
	position: relative;
	left:565px;
	top:-1030px;
	width:145px;
	z-index: 10;
	height: 100px;
		}
		#buyalbum {
	position: relative;
	left:60px;
	top:-695px;
	width:145px;
	z-index: 10;
	height: 117px;
		}
		#centertitle {
	position: relative;
	left:220px;
	top:-1321px;
	width:145px;
	z-index: 10;
	height: 43px;
		}
html>body #centertitle {
	position: relative;
	left:220px;
	top:-1315px;
	width:145px;
	z-index: 10;
	height: 43px;
		}
		#footer {
	position: relative;
	left:130px;
	top:-685px;
	width:98px;
	z-index: 10;
	height: 27px;
		}
		#footer2 {
	position: relative;
	left:525px;
	top:-710px;
	width:233px;
	z-index: 10;
	height: 27px;
		}
		
		#header {
	position: relative;
	left:40px;
	top:-770px;
	z-index: 10;
		}
		#background {
	position: static;
	left:95px;
	width:757px;
	background-image: url(../images/site_bg2.jpg);
	height: 793px;
	z-index: 1;
	top: 0;
		}

	#centercontent {
	voice-family: "\"}\"";
	voice-family: inherit;
	width: 300px;
	position: relative;
	left: 230px;
	top: -1615px;
	z-index: 10;
		}
	html>body #centercontent {
		}

#centercontent_index {	
	voice-family: "\"}\"";
	voice-family: inherit;
	width: 300px;
	height: 410px;
	overflow: auto;
	position: relative;
	left: 230px;
	top: -1535px;
	z-index: 10;
		}
	html>body #centercontent {
		}

			
#rightcontent {
	position: relative;
	top:-751px;
	width:157px;
	z-index: 10;
	left: 558px;
	height: 106px;
		}
	#banner {
	
	height:212px;
	z-index: 10;
		}
	html>body #banner {
	height:212px;
		}
		
	p,h1,pre {
		margin:0px 10px 10px 10px;
		}
		
	h1 {
		font-size:14px;
		padding-top:10px;
		}
		
	#banner h1 {
		font-size:14px;
		padding:10px 10px 0px 10px;
		margin:0px;
		}
	
	#rightcontent p {
		font-size:10px
		}
	
.style1 {	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
}
a:link {
	color: #990000;
	text-decoration: none;
}
a:visited {
	text-decoration: none;
	color: #990000;
}
a:hover {
	text-decoration: underline;
}
a:active {
	text-decoration: none;
}
.style2 {color: #990000}
.style3 {font-family: Arial, Helvetica, sans-serif; font-size: 10px; font-weight: bold; }

/* next three styles for events copied from sangament.com */

.eventInfo {
	padding: 1em 0.5em;
}

.header {
	font-weight: bold;
	text-transform: uppercase;
	color: #864;
}

.eventHeader {
	font-weight: bold;
}

.eventHeader .date {
  font-size: 110%;
  color: #333;
  margin-bottom: 0.25em;
}

.eventHeader .title {
  font-size: 125%;
  margin-top: 0;
}

